广州扁平化SVG设计公司提供专业服务

深圳包装袋设计公司 更新时间 2025-09-03 扁平化SVG设计

近年来,扁平化设计风格在网页和应用程序设计中越来越流行。这种风格以其简洁、直观的视觉效果和快速加载的特点赢得了广大用户的青睐。与此同时,SVG(可缩放矢量图形)作为一种基于XML的图像格式,因其矢量缩放特性和轻量级文件大小,成为实现高分辨率设备和响应式网页设计的理想选择。

扁平化SVG设计

为什么选择SVG?

SVG的最大优势在于其矢量特性,这意味着它可以无限放大而不失真,非常适合在各种屏幕尺寸上使用。此外,SVG文件通常比位图格式(如PNG或JPEG)更小,有助于提升页面加载速度,特别是在移动设备上。这些特性使得SVG成为现代网页设计中的重要工具。

解析扁平化SVG设计的基本技巧

简化形状

扁平化设计的核心在于简化元素,去除不必要的细节。通过使用基本几何形状来构建复杂的图标或图案,可以使设计更加清晰易懂。例如,在设计一个简单的汉堡菜单图标时,可以仅用几个矩形和线条组合而成。

使用有限色板

为了保持设计的一致性和简约感,建议使用有限的颜色调色板。这不仅有助于统一整体视觉风格,还能减少文件大小。通常情况下,3到5种颜色已经足够满足大多数设计需求。

优化路径数据

在创建SVG时,确保路径数据尽可能简洁是非常重要的。冗余的点和曲线会增加文件体积,并可能导致渲染性能下降。使用矢量编辑软件中的“简化路径”功能可以帮助去除不必要的节点,从而优化文件结构。

常见工具与代码实现方法

Adobe Illustrator

Adobe Illustrator是设计师常用的矢量图形编辑软件之一。它提供了丰富的工具集,方便用户创建和编辑SVG文件。通过Illustrator导出SVG时,记得选择“最小化文件大小”选项以进一步压缩文件。

在线SVG优化器

对于那些没有专业设计软件的开发者来说,在线SVG优化器是一个不错的选择。这些工具可以自动清理SVG文件中的冗余信息,并将其压缩到最小尺寸。常见的在线优化器包括SVGO和SVGOMG。

CSS动画集成

除了静态图形外,SVG还支持CSS动画。通过将CSS动画应用于SVG元素,可以为网站增添动态效果,增强用户体验。例如,利用@keyframes规则定义动画序列,并通过animation属性将其应用到特定的SVG元素上。

避免锯齿与兼容性问题的实用贴士

抗锯齿处理

尽管SVG本身具有抗锯齿特性,但在某些低分辨率屏幕上仍可能出现锯齿现象。为了避免这种情况,可以在CSS中添加shape-rendering: crispEdges;属性来强制浏览器使用最接近像素的颜色值进行渲染。

兼容性检查

由于不同浏览器对SVG的支持程度有所差异,因此在发布前务必进行全面的兼容性测试。可以通过Can I Use等网站查询最新的浏览器支持情况,并根据需要调整代码以确保最佳显示效果。

总结

通过掌握上述扁平化SVG设计技巧,设计师和开发者能够显著提升作品的视觉体验与设计效率。无论是简化形状、使用有限色板还是优化路径数据,每一个步骤都旨在让设计更加高效且美观。同时,合理利用现有工具和技术手段,则能进一步提高工作流效率并解决实际遇到的问题。

我们致力于为您提供专业的设计服务,帮助您打造高质量的扁平化SVG设计。如果您有任何关于设计或开发方面的需求,请随时联系我们。我们的团队将以最快的速度响应您的请求,并提供最优质的解决方案。您可以拨打17723342546(微信同号),期待与您合作!

扁平化SVG设计 工期报价咨询